What is Butter Motion?

Butter Motion is an AI-powered plugin developed by Butter Motion that enables video editors and content creators to generate motion graphics directly from text prompts. It integrates as an extension within Adobe Premiere Pro, allowing users to create dynamic visuals and place them onto their timelines as editable video clips. The tool automates the design process, transforming descriptions like "a chart that grows bar by bar" or "a neon logo reveal" into rendered animations on the user's local machine. This streamlines the workflow for editors by reducing the need for external animation software like Adobe After Effects.

How to Use Butter Motion

To use Butter Motion, users install the plugin for Adobe Premiere Pro and then interact with it directly within the editing software. The process involves inputting text prompts to generate motion graphics.

  • 1Install the Butter Motion desktop application, which manages the Premiere Pro plugin.
  • 2Open Adobe Premiere Pro and access the Butter Motion extension.
  • 3Type a text prompt describing the desired motion graphic (e.g., "a growing bar chart").
  • 4Select a quality tier (Flash, Balance, or Ultra) for generation.
  • 5Initiate the generation process, which renders the animation locally.
  • 6The generated motion graphic is placed directly onto the Premiere Pro timeline as an editable video clip.

Butter Motion Pricing & Plans

Butter Motion operates on a freemium model with a credit-based system for generating motion graphics. The cost per generation varies based on the selected quality tier. Users can purchase one-time 'top-up packs' of credits that do not expire. While the website mentions 'Plans: Pro & Studio,' specific monthly or yearly pricing for these subscription tiers was not detailed in the available information. Subscribers to these plans receive free customization controls, allowing unlimited adjustments without additional credit expenditure. The first edit on any generation is free, with subsequent AI-handled tweaks costing 5 credits each.

  • Freemium: Access to basic functionality and initial credits.
  • Flash Generation: 7 credits per generation (quickest, lowest cost).
  • Balance Generation: 10 credits per generation (default, balanced speed and quality).
  • Ultra Generation: 15 credits per generation (most complex, highest quality, slowest).
  • Small Top-Up Pack: 100 credits (one-time purchase, never expires).
  • Medium Top-Up Pack: 500 credits (one-time purchase, better per-credit rate).
  • Large Top-Up Pack: 1,000 credits (one-time purchase, best per-credit rate).
